GOP Candidate for Congress Robin Smith; Knoxville on the 4th of July
Broadcast Date: July 5, 2009

We're many months away from the August state primary, but already candidates are lining up for a number of high profile posts.
On this week's program, Robin smith, the former state Republican party chairwoman, talks about her quest to replace Zach Wamp in the U.S. House of Representatives.
Later, Metropulse columnist and historian Jack Neeley joins Gene Patterson to talk about Knoxville's connection to Independence Day.
And in the Final Word, 6 News political analyst George Korda and Tennessee Conservative Union member Kelvin Moxley share their insight on some of the week's news events.
